    Peru energy storage power plant

    The facility, known as Chilca-BESS, is made up of 84 cabinets of lithium-ion batteries. Now in commercial operation, it is the largest energy storage system of its kind in Peru, according to the Peruvian ministry of energy and mining. The BESS is located at a thermal power plant Engie operates in Chilca, Peru. (MTerra Solar), has successfully completed the initial grid. Paris, 3 October 2023 – NHOA Energy, NHOA Group's (NHOA. PA, formerly Engie EPS) business unit dedicated to energy storage, is pleased to announce the successful commissioning of a 31MWh battery storage system for ENGIE Energía Perú, supplied on a turn-key basis and located in its ChilcaUno.     Does solar power generation have any safety risks

    Workers in the solar energy industry are potentially exposed to a variety of serious hazards, such as arc flashes (which include arc flash burn and blast hazards), electric shock, falls, and thermal burn hazards that can cause injury and death. Various worker health and safety hazards exist in the manufacture, installation, and maintenance of solar energy.     Solar power plant in Tajikistan

    Tajikistan will implement its first large-scale 500 MW solar power project with two 250 MW plants in Asht and Jayhun districts, aiming to boost energy independence and renewable energy capacity by 2026. Hydropower remains the dominant source of electricity generation, accounting for nearly 98 percent of the country's power mix, with the remainder derived from hydrocarbons and minor sources.
